Output e2c7db51e352cded5e36abbc4f023b928de2eae19fd0f3e61fc23f165d2c1927:1

value
15848199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c69682d86bc0c11c2cfaa36d1647f7218609d631 OP_EQUAL
address
3Ko42DpHiiXAi2iZzGro2jP26xamLYRiEm
transaction
e2c7db51e352cded5e36abbc4f023b928de2eae19fd0f3e61fc23f165d2c1927
confirmations
277608
spent
true